Programme Note

The great Berner Symphonie-Orchester, conducted by Mario Venzago, performs the most significant of Beethovens works in the first of two concerts this season. Before the interval, Swiss pianist Oliver Schnyder performs Beethovens Piano Concerto No. 2.

The orchestra ends the evening with Beethovens Symphony No. 3, the musical masterpiece which was revolutionary in breaking the structures of the Classical period through its length and range of emotion, and is often cited as the beginning of the Romantic period in music.

The second concert is on Friday 10 April.
